BASIC Session Chairman: Thomas Cheatham Speaker: Thomas E. Kurtz PAPER: BASIC Thomas E. Kurtz Darthmouth College 1. Background 1.1. Dartmouth College Dartmouth College is a small university dating from 1769, and dedicated "for the educa- tion and instruction of Youth of the Indian Tribes in this Land in reading, writing and all parts of learning . and also of English Youth and any others" (Wheelock, 1769). The undergraduate student body (now nearly 4000) outnumbers all graduate students by more than 5 to 1, and majors predominantly in the Social Sciences and the Humanities (over 75%). In 1940 a milestone event, not well remembered until recently (Loveday, 1977), took place at Dartmouth. Dr. George Stibitz of the Bell Telephone Laboratories demonstrated publicly for the first time, at the annual meeting of the American Mathematical Society, the remote use of a computer over a communications line. The computer was a relay cal- culator designed to carry out arithmetic on complex numbers. The terminal was a Model 26 Teletype. Another milestone event occurred in the summer of 1956 when John McCarthy orga- nized at Dartmouth a summer research project on "artificial intelligence" (the first known use of this phrase). The computer scientists attending decided a new language was needed; thus was born LISP. [See the paper by McCarthy, pp. 173-185 in this volume. Ed.] 1.2. Development of time shared basic system processor for Hewlett Packard 2100 series computers by John Sidney Shema A thesis submitted to the Graduate Faculty in partial fulfillment of the requirements for the degree of MASTER OF SCIENCE in Electrical Engineering Montana State University © Copyright by John Sidney Shema (1974) Abstract: The subject of this thesis is the development of a low cost time share BASIC system which is capable of providing useful computer services for both commercial and educational users. The content of this thesis is summarized as follows:First, a review of the historical work leading to the development of time share principles is presented. Second, software design considerations and related restrictions imposed by hardware capabilities and their impact on system performance are discussed. Third, 1000D BASIC operating system specifications are described by detailing user software capabilities and system operator capabilities. Fourth, TSB system organization is explained in detail. This involves presenting TSB system modules and describing communication between modules. A detailed study is made of the TSB system tables and organization of the system and user discs. Fifth, unique features of 1000D BASIC are described from a functional point of view. Sixth, a summary of the material presented in the thesis is made. Seventh, the recommendation is made that error detection and recovery techniques be pursued in order to improve system reliability. LinuxFocus. _________________ _________________ _________________ Translated to English by: Georges Tarbouriech <gt(at)Linuxfocus.org> Introduction Even if it appeared later than other languages on the computing scene, BASIC quickly became widespread on many non Unix systems as a replacement for the scripting languages natively found on Unix. This is probably the main reason why this language is rarely used by Unix people. Unix had a more powerful scripting language from the first day on. Like other scripting languages, BASIC is mostly an interpreted one and uses a rather simple syntax, without data types, apart from a distinction between strings and numbers. Historically, the name of the language comes from its simplicity and from the fact it allows to easily teach programming to students. Unfortunately, the lack of standardization lead to many different versions mostly incompatible with each other. We can even say there are as many versions as interpreters what makes BASIC hardly portable. Despite these drawbacks and many others that the "true programmers" will remind us, BASIC stays an option to be taken into account to quickly develop small programs. This has been especially true for many years because of the Integrated Development Environment found in Windows versions allowing graphical interface design in a few mouse clicks. -

Computers 2014, 3, 69-116; doi:10.3390/computers3030069 OPEN ACCESS computers ISSN 2073-431X www.mdpi.com/journal/computers Article An ECMA-55 Minimal BASIC Compiler for x86-64 Linux® John Gatewood Ham Burapha University, Faculty of Informatics, 169 Bangsaen Road, Tambon Saensuk, Amphur Muang, Changwat Chonburi 20131, Thailand; E-mail: [email protected] Received: 24 July 2014; in revised form: 17 September 2014 / Accepted: 1 October 2014 / Published: 1 October 2014 Abstract: This paper describes a new non-optimizing compiler for the ECMA-55 Minimal BASIC language that generates x86-64 assembler code for use on the x86-64 Linux® [1] 3.x platform. The compiler was implemented in C99 and the generated assembly language is in the AT&T style and is for the GNU assembler. The generated code is stand-alone and does not require any shared libraries to run, since it makes system calls to the Linux® kernel directly. The floating point math uses the Single Instruction Multiple Data (SIMD) instructions and the compiler fully implements all of the floating point exception handling required by the ECMA-55 standard. This compiler is designed to be small, simple, and easy to understand for people who want to study a compiler that actually implements full error checking on floating point on x86-64 CPUs even if those people have little programming experience. The generated assembly code is also designed to be simple to read. Keywords: BASIC; compiler; AMD64; INTEL64; EM64T; x86-64; assembly 1. Kurtz Professor of Mathematics and Computer Science, Emeritus An Interview Conducted by Daniel Daily Hanover, New Hampshire June 20, 2002 July 2, 2002 DOH-44 Special Collections Dartmouth College Hanover, New Hampshire Thomas Kurtz Interview INTERVIEWEE: Thomas Kurtz INTERVIEWER: Daniel Daily PLACE: Hanover, NH DATE: June 20, 2002 DAILY: Today is June 20, 2002 and I am speaking with Professor Emeritus Thomas Kurtz. Professor Kurtz, one of the first questions I would like to ask is what brought you to Dartmouth and specifically the math department here? KURTZ: It was primarily the attraction of the geographical area. I was a graduate student at Princeton and, incidentally, at one point I lived less than a block from the Kemenys [John G. and Jean Kemeny], but I didnʼt know them down there because we were in different spheres. I think by that time he was a junior faculty member of philosophy and I was a lowly graduate student in mathematics. At any rate, in the summer of 1955, my first wife and I and our family came up to Hanover to visit people who we knew down at Princeton, particularly Bob [Robert] and Anita Norman who had moved up here. He had taken a position in the math department -- or was here for the summer at least -- and [J.] Laurie and Joan Snell, whom we knew quite well at Princeton. So we came up and spent a week…I donʼt know…and thought, “Gee, this is a lovely part of the country.” I had previously thought, “Well, obviously I am going to go out west where men are men and women are glad of it type of thing in the mountains." Then, I think it was about March of the year I was scheduled to finish my degree at Princeton and I had mentioned something about wanting to go to Dartmouth because one of my friends had said that Kemeny was in town recruiting.
